The waves started crashing on Israel 's shores on Monday evening , when Britain , France and Canada issued a joint statement condemning its "egregious" actions in Gaza .

On Tuesday , Britain suspended trade talks with Israel and said a 2023 road map for future cooperation was being reviewed.

A fresh round of sanctions were imposed on Jewish settlers, including Daniela Weiss .

At the end of his recent tour of the Gulf , Donald Trump said "a lot of people are starving". White House officials indicated the US president was frustrated with the war and wanted the Israeli government to "wrap it up". But while other western leaders release expressions of outrage, Trump is saying almost nothing..
